Product
Tata Chemicals' Diverse Basic Chemistry Portfolio forms the bedrock of its offering, encompassing essential industrial chemicals like soda ash, sodium bicarbonate, and salt. These are not just products; they are fundamental building blocks for a vast array of industries, from glass manufacturing and detergents to textiles and pharmaceuticals.
The company's global standing in these core chemicals is substantial. Tata Chemicals ranks as the 3rd largest producer of soda ash globally and the 5th largest for sodium bicarbonate. This significant market presence underscores the widespread reliance on their products for critical industrial processes worldwide.
Tata Chemicals is strategically prioritizing its specialty products segment, which encompasses high-margin offerings like specialty silica and prebiotics such as FOSSENCE®. This focus is designed to insulate the company from the unpredictable swings often seen in commodity chemical prices.
The growth in this segment is directly fueled by innovation, catering to emerging market demands in areas like advanced tire manufacturing, the burgeoning nutraceuticals sector for digestive wellness, and the critical field of sustainable agriculture. For instance, their specialty silica is a key component in fuel-efficient tires, a market that saw significant global growth in 2024.

Place
Tata Chemicals boasts an impressive global manufacturing footprint, with 15 facilities strategically located across Asia, North America, Europe, and Africa. This extensive network, including key operations in India, the United States, the United Kingdom, and Kenya, allows for efficient market penetration and robust supply chain management. For instance, their North American operations are crucial for serving the significant demand in that region.

Diverse Distribution Channels
Tata Chemicals employs a diverse distribution strategy, blending direct sales with a robust network of channel partners to reach various customer segments. For its industrial and basic chemistry products, direct engagement with large clients is common, ensuring tailored solutions and strong relationships. This approach was evident in their continued supply agreements in the industrial chemicals sector throughout 2024.
Conversely, consumer-facing products, such as Tata Salt, rely heavily on an expansive retail distribution network. This includes traditional kirana stores, modern trade outlets, and e-commerce platforms, ensuring widespread availability. In 2024, Tata Chemicals continued to expand its reach in rural markets, reportedly increasing its distribution points by over 15% to tap into growing consumer demand.

Investments in Capacity Expansion and Digitalization
Tata Chemicals is making significant strides in capacity expansion, aiming to boost its soda ash production by a substantial one million tonnes. This expansion is strategically spread across key locations including India, Kenya, and the United States, bolstering its global supply chain and market reach.
Alongside physical expansion, the company is heavily investing in digitalization. These initiatives are designed to streamline manufacturing processes and optimize supply chain operations, ultimately leading to greater efficiency and an improved customer experience.
- Capacity Expansion: Aims to add 1 million tonnes of soda ash capacity across India, Kenya, and the US.

Price
Pricing for Tata Chemicals' basic chemistry products, such as soda ash, is heavily dictated by global supply and demand, alongside the inherent volatility of commodity price cycles. This means their pricing strategy must be agile, adapting to fluctuating market conditions to remain competitive.
The company actively manages its pricing to navigate periods of intense pricing pressure, often brought on by softer demand. A key element in their approach is a relentless focus on cost-effective production, which directly underpins their ability to offer competitive prices in these challenging environments.
Tata Chemicals employs value-based pricing for its specialty products, a strategy that directly links price to the perceived benefits and performance enhancements these offerings provide to customers. This approach acknowledges the significant investment in research and development that underpins these advanced solutions.
This pricing strategy allows Tata Chemicals to capture higher margins within its specialty chemicals division, thereby insulating the company from the price fluctuations and lower profitability often seen in the more commoditized basic chemicals market. For instance, the company's focus on high-value additives and performance materials commands premium pricing.
The premium pricing for specialty products like those in their silica or agrochemical segments, which saw significant growth contributing to their overall revenue in the 2023-2024 fiscal year, reinforces the brand's image as a provider of innovative and high-quality solutions, aligning perfectly with their premium market positioning.
Tata Chemicals' pricing strategies are deeply intertwined with the global economic landscape. Broader economic conditions, such as inflation rates and interest rate policies in major economies, directly impact the cost of production and the purchasing power of their customers. For instance, rising energy costs in 2024, a persistent theme, put upward pressure on manufacturing expenses for chemicals like soda ash.
Global supply chain disruptions, a recurring challenge since the pandemic, also play a significant role. Delays or increased costs in sourcing raw materials or delivering finished products can necessitate price adjustments. The company actively monitors these logistical hurdles to ensure competitive pricing, especially considering the volatile nature of freight costs throughout 2024 and into 2025.
Demand trends in key end-user industries, such as construction (glass manufacturing) and consumer goods (detergents), are critical drivers. A slowdown in construction activity, for example, could dampen demand for soda ash, potentially leading to more competitive pricing. Conversely, robust growth in the detergent sector in emerging markets in 2024 provided a more stable demand base, supporting pricing.
Market volatility, particularly in the soda ash segment, remains a key consideration for Tata Chemicals' pricing outlook. Fluctuations in global soda ash prices, influenced by supply-demand imbalances and producer capacities, require continuous monitoring and agile pricing adjustments. For example, reports in early 2025 indicated a stabilization in soda ash prices after a period of significant swings in 2024.
